Yesavage's 9 Ks: A Deep Dive
Yesavage's 9 Ks represent nine crucial elements contributing to effective pitching. While some interpretations exist, the core principles remain consistent: Kinematics, Kinetics, Knowledge, Komposure, Kontrol, Kounter-Movement, Kompetition, Konditioning, and Keep Score. Let's examine each one individually:
1. Kinematics: This refers to the mechanics of the pitching motion – the angles, velocities, and accelerations involved in the delivery. Optimizing kinematics is crucial for efficiency and injury prevention. A smooth, repeatable delivery minimizes stress on the throwing arm and maximizes velocity and control.
- Analysis: High-speed video analysis is invaluable for identifying flaws in kinematics. Coaches can pinpoint issues like arm slot inconsistencies, inefficient leg drive, or late arm action.
- Improvement: Working with a pitching coach to address mechanical flaws is paramount. Drills focusing on specific aspects of the delivery, such as long toss for arm strength and flexibility or plyometrics for leg drive, can significantly improve kinematics.
2. Kinetics: This deals with the forces involved in the pitching motion – the power generation, momentum transfer, and torque produced. Efficient kinetics translates into greater velocity and improved command.
- Analysis: Force plates and other biomechanical tools can quantify the forces generated during the pitching motion. This data allows for a precise assessment of power generation and its efficiency.
- Improvement: Strength and conditioning programs designed specifically for pitchers are crucial for developing the necessary power and explosiveness. Focus on core strength, leg strength, and rotational power are key components of kinetic improvement.
3. Knowledge: This encompasses the understanding of pitching strategy, scouting reports, and the ability to adapt to different hitters and situations. Pitchers must know their strengths, their weaknesses, and their opponent's tendencies.
- Analysis: Studying opposing batters' tendencies, including pitch selection patterns, weaknesses, and hitting approaches, allows for strategic pitch sequencing.
- Improvement: Extensive video review of past performances and preparation before each game is vital. Analyzing scouting reports, identifying hitters' vulnerabilities, and creating customized game plans are all key components of improving this K.
4. Komposure: Maintaining composure under pressure is crucial for success on the mound. A pitcher's ability to stay calm and focused, even in high-stakes situations, directly impacts performance.
- Analysis: Observe a pitcher's demeanor during crucial moments of a game – are they able to remain composed despite setbacks or high-pressure situations?
- Improvement: Mental conditioning techniques, such as mindfulness exercises and visualization, are effective tools for developing composure. Building confidence through consistent practice and positive self-talk also contributes significantly.
5. Kontrol: Command and control are essential for pitching success. This "K" refers to the ability to consistently throw pitches where intended.
- Analysis: Analyzing pitch location data, such as strike percentage and walk rate, reveals the level of control a pitcher possesses.
- Improvement: Consistent practice, focusing on pinpoint accuracy, is paramount. Drills like bullpens and live batting practice provide opportunities to refine command. Proper grip and release mechanics are fundamental to control.
6. Kounter-Movement: This involves using a variety of pitch types and movement patterns to keep hitters off balance. A well-rounded arsenal, including fastballs, breaking balls, and off-speed pitches, is crucial for success.
- Analysis: Evaluating a pitcher's pitch mix and effectiveness against different types of hitters provides insights into their repertoire's effectiveness.
- Improvement: Developing and mastering different pitch types with diverse movement profiles is crucial. This requires patience, dedication, and consistent practice to refine each pitch.
7. Kompetition: The competitive spirit and mental toughness are vital for success. A pitcher must possess the drive to win and the resilience to overcome setbacks.
- Analysis: Observe a pitcher's determination, resilience, and competitive fire both during games and practice.
- Improvement: Developing a strong competitive drive involves setting challenging goals, embracing competition, and viewing failures as opportunities for growth.
8. Konditioning: Physical conditioning is fundamental to pitching performance. Pitchers need to be in peak physical condition to withstand the rigors of a long season.
- Analysis: Assessing a pitcher's strength, endurance, flexibility, and overall physical fitness provides valuable insights into their preparedness.
- Improvement: A well-structured training program that incorporates strength training, conditioning exercises, and flexibility work is critical for maximizing performance and minimizing injury risk.
9. Keep Score: This emphasizes the importance of meticulous self-assessment and continuous learning. Pitchers need to constantly analyze their performance, identify areas for improvement, and adapt their approach accordingly.
- Analysis: Regularly reviewing game data, performance metrics, and video footage allows for a thorough self-assessment and identification of areas needing further development.
- Improvement: Developing a personal record-keeping system to track performance metrics, note observations, and analyze strengths and weaknesses is invaluable for continuous improvement. Working with a coach to review performance and strategize improvement is also crucial.

FAQ
Q1: Can Yesavage's 9 Ks be applied to all levels of baseball?
A1: Absolutely. While the framework is particularly relevant for high-level pitching, the principles are applicable to pitchers of all skill levels. Adapting the level of detail and the complexity of analysis to the specific needs of the player is key.
Q2: How often should pitchers analyze their performance using Yesavage's 9 Ks?
A2: Regular self-assessment is crucial. Ideally, pitchers should analyze their performance after each game or training session, focusing on specific areas for improvement. More in-depth analysis, perhaps with a coach, should occur more regularly – weekly or bi-weekly – to track progress over time.
Q3: Is there a specific order of importance to the 9 Ks?
A3: While all 9 Ks are important, there's no strict hierarchy. The relative importance can vary depending on the individual pitcher's strengths and weaknesses. However, a solid foundation in kinematics, kinetics, and control is essential before moving onto more advanced aspects like counter-movement and competition.
Q4: How can a pitcher improve their "Komposure" under pressure?
A4: Mental training techniques like mindfulness, visualization, and positive self-talk are crucial. Building confidence through consistent practice and focusing on the process rather than the outcome can significantly reduce pressure.
Q5: How does Konditioning relate specifically to preventing injuries?
A5: Proper conditioning builds strength, flexibility, and endurance, which reduce the risk of overuse injuries. A well-structured program prevents muscle imbalances, improves neuromuscular control, and enhances recovery capabilities, making injuries less likely.
